Tabakoshi, a serene village nestled in the foothills of the Himalayas near Mirik, West Bengal, offers a tranquil escape amidst nature’s embrace. Located close to the Indo-Nepal border, this charming hamlet is known for its picturesque landscapes, flowing rivers, and lush greenery. The primary attraction of Tabakoshi is its unspoiled natural beauty. The Rangbhang River flows through the village, offering opportunities for fishing and leisurely strolls along its banks. The surrounding hills are covered with tea gardens, adding a touch of emerald green to the landscape. Orange orchards dot the hillsides, adding bursts of color and a sweet fragrance to the air, especially during the harvest season.

A visit to Dawaipani is an opportunity to reconnect with nature, breathe in the fresh mountain air, and experience the tranquility of the Himalayas away from the crowds. It’s a destination for those seeking peace, solitude, and a genuine connection with the natural world. The name “Dawaipani” translates to “medicinal water,” hinting at the presence of natural springs in the area believed to possess healing properties. While the medicinal properties might be debated, the pristine beauty and serene atmosphere are undeniable. Perched at a considerable altitude, Dawaipani provides breathtaking panoramic views of the surrounding valleys, forested hills, and snow-capped Himalayan peaks. The landscape is characterized by its lush greenery, with dense forests of pine, oak, and rhododendron covering the slopes. This rich biodiversity makes it a haven for birdwatchers and nature photographers.

Takdah is surrounded by sprawling tea estates, including the famous Rangli Rangliot Tea Garden and Teesta Valley Tea Estate, where visitors can witness tea processing and enjoy fresh Darjeeling tea. The region is also home to beautiful orchids, with the Takdah Orchid Centre being a must-visit for nature lovers. Nearby attractions include Tinchuley, known for its panoramic viewpoints, and the Lamahatta Eco Park, which offers peaceful nature trails. The Dechen Pema Tshoiling Monastery in Takdah provides a spiritual experience with stunning views. With its cool climate, misty forests, and breathtaking landscapes, Takdah is an ideal destination for those seeking tranquility, scenic beauty, and a glimpse into colonial history. It remains one of the most peaceful and untouched spots near Darjeeling.
